The deal with his NCAA clearance is where he attended classes wasn't where he played iirc. The school he actually attended was some sort of alternative charter school that had accreditation issues and many of his core classes weren't a part of his state's approved curriculum, hence 1/3 to 1/2 of his HS credits were basically trash.
